Installation Precautions:
1. The rectifier should be installed in a location with good ventilation and good heat dissipation. High temperature will be generated when the rectifier is working, and poor heat dissipation will damage the rectifier
2. The installation steps of the rectifier are to connect the AC input line, the positive and negative outputs are not connected, start the locomotive, measure the positive and negative output voltages, and when the voltage range is reasonable, plug in the positive and negative wires, and then test the positive and negative of the battery or rectifier Check whether the voltage at the end is within a reasonable range. If the voltage range is unreasonable, stop using it and give feedback. The entire installation process should be recorded and saved.
3. Note that the rectifier should be closely attached to the frame when installing it, which is good for heat conduction. You can also add thermally conductive glue between the rectifier and the frame
4. No other wires should be pressed between the rectifier and the frame
5. There should be a fuse fuse between the positive outlet of the rectifier and the battery to prevent the overvoltage from burning out other electrical devices when the rectifier is damaged.
